502 HINTS TO THE CHILDLESS. or quite paralyzed, the menses are too slight. When inflammatory,ulcerous, or tumorous affections are present, the menses are too pro-fuse ; and sometimes fleshy substances or fibres pass with the men-strual discharges. When the ovaries are dropsical, the menstrualFig. 131. fluids are often found to be very watery, with alightish appearance oryellowish color. Tumor-ous and dropsical ovariesin some cases, producevery great abnormal dis-thb ovary in old age. tention, so that the female is supposed to be pregnant by those not capable of judging. It iswell in these affections that females so suffering are not liable topregnancy, for they could hardly survive the period of gestation.Nor is it best that females should become pregnant until these difficul-ties are entirely eradicated, for pregnancy is possible when only a par-tial cure is effected.
